Ordinals
beta
Address 18GCMNK3o4KdWAFHuakyhn3weBWT4g9pkM
sat balance
10900000
outputs
472314940dc9ccafa1b18d29cbb7f5f2b00f87cd383a83af0d2887b9a2cf6ca4:1